Default Need a Sources of "Styrene" for Gelcoat Repair

I am about to repair some areas of the gelcoat skin of my fiberglass
boat. I am supposed to use something called "styrene" to be brushed on
the old gelcoat in order re-activate the gelcoat for a better bonding
between the old and the new gelcoat. And I am also supposed to use it
as a thinner to thin the gelcoat before spraying it using a Preval
spray gun. But I cannot find it in Home Depot or local marine supply
stores (such as BoaterWorld). Does it go by a different name? Where
can I find it? Can I use acetone instead?
